Search for specific global education scholarships and funding outside of Chapman. Funds from external scholarships will be supplemental to existing financial aid. Award methods must be arranged independently with the scholarship provider. Deadlines and eligibility will vary by scholarship - plan early! Many applications are due early in the semester before your global education program.
